The Roman pilum which is in effect a relatively short range, single use, heavy throwing weapon was used by the Legionaries against charging enemies, or before making contact with an enemy formation. In conversation with Roman reenacters some years ago, they said it was possible to throw 2 pilum at a charging enemy before contact. Because the soft iron shaft bent on impact with an opponents shield or body it was very much a single use weapon which could not be hurled back at the original thrower.
The (5+P)indicates it as a missile or shooting weapon and is therefore used during the shooting phase of the Hordes and Heroes system, but unlike other missile weapons only has a single hex range - this is to simulate how it was used historically. Like other missile weapons the effect can be reduced by the opponents armour or use of a shield (A1 or A2), adding 1 or 2 to the dice score required to hit. The number of hits received and the result inflicted upon the target enemy unit is then referenced using the combat results table.
There is no requirement for the Legionaries to always use the pilum on first contact with the first enemy unit, it can be retained and used on another first contact with another enemy unit later on in the game if so desired.
